Está en la página 1de 32

1

INSTALACIN Y CONFIGURACIN DEL


SERVIDOR DE CORREO EN REDHAT 6.2




MARIBEL MUOZ TOBN



INSTRUCTOR
JOHN ANDERSON CASTRILLN GARCA


SERVICIO NACIONAL DE APRENDIZAJE SENA
CENTRO DE SERVICIOS Y GESTIN EMPRESARIAL
TECNOLOGA EN GESTIN DE REDES DE DATOS

FICHA 464324

MEDELLN, ANTIOQUA

2014
2

CONTENIDO
SERVIDOR DE CORREO 3
INSTALACIN Y CONFIGURACIN 5




















3

SERVIDOR DE CORREO
Un servidor de correo es una aplicacin de red ubicada en un servidor en internet. El
MTA (Mail Transfer Agent) tiene varias formas de comunicarse con otros servidores
de correo:
Recibe los mensajes desde otro MTA. Acta como "servidor" de otros
servidores.
Enva los mensajes hacia otro MTA. Acta como un "cliente" de otros
servidores.
Acta como intermediario entre un "Mail Submision Agent" y otro MTA.
Algunas soluciones de correo que incluyen un MTA son: Sendmail, qmail, Postfix,
Exim, Mdaemon, Mercury Mail Transport System, Lotus Notes (IBM) y Microsoft
Exchange Server.
Por defecto el protocolo estndar para la transferencia de correos entre servidores es
el SMTP, o Protocolo Simple de Transferencia de Correo. Est definido en el RFC
2821 y es un estndar oficial de Internet
Un servidor de correo realiza una serie de procesos que tienen la finalidad de
transportar informacin entre los distintos usuarios. Usualmente el envo de un correo
electrnico tiene como fin que un usuario (remitente) cree un correo electrnico y lo
enve a otro (destinatario). Esta accin toma tpicamente 5 pasos:
El usuario inicial crea un "correo electrnico"; un archivo que cumple los
estndares de un correo electrnico. Usar para ello una aplicacin ad-hoc.
Las aplicaciones ms usadas, en indistinto orden son: Outlook Express
(Microsoft), Microsoft Outlook, Mozilla Thunderbird (Mozilla), Pegasus Mail
(David Harris), Lotus Notes (IBM), etc.
El archivo creado es enviado a un almacn; administrado por el servidor de
correo local al usuario remitente del correo; donde se genera una solicitud de
envo.
El servicio MTA local al usuario inicial recupera este archivo e inicia la
negociacin con el servidor del destinatario para el envo del mismo.
El servidor del destinatario valida la operacin y recibe el correo, depositndolo
en el "buzn" correspondiente al usuario receptor del correo. El "buzn" no es
otra cosa que un registro en una base de datos.
4

Finalmente el software del cliente receptor del correo recupera este archivo o
"correo" desde el servidor almacenando una copia en la base de datos del
programa cliente de correo, ubicada en la computadora del cliente que recibe
el correo.
A diferencia de un servicio postal clsico, que recibe un nico paquete y lo transporta
de un lugar a otro; el servicio de correo electrnico copia varias veces la informacin
que corresponde al correo electrnico.
Este proceso que en la vida real ocurre de manera muy rpida involucra muchos
protocolos. Por ejemplo para ubicar el servidor de destino se utiliza el servicio DNS, el
que reporta un tipo especial de registro para servidores de correo. Una vez ubicado,
para obtener los mensajes del servidor de correos receptor, los usuarios se sirven de
clientes de correo que utilizan el protocolo POP3 o el protocolo IMAP para recuperar
los "correos" del servidor y almacenarlos en sus computadores locales.

5

INSTALACIN Y CONFIGURACIN
NOTA: Para poder comenzar a instalar nuestro servidor de correo debemos tener
funcionando correctamente los servicios:
DNS
DHCP
HTTP
FTP
SSH
LDAP
En el siguiente enlace podrs encontrar la configuracin de estos servicios
www.todoenredes.weebly.com
Principalmente vamos a observar con que usuarios estamos logueados y en qu
sistema nos encontramos:

Ahora vamos a comprobar si tenemos instalado nuestro servicio Postfix

Si nuestro servidor Postfix no estuviese instalado simplemente colocamos los
siguientes comandos para instalarlo yum install Postfix
Verifiquemos el nombre de nuestro dominio

6

Verifiquemos nuestra Ip

Como podemos observar nuestra ip es 192.168.20.10 con mascara 255.255.255.0
Primero agregaremos un archivo al /etc/hosts para que tengamos conectividad a un
subdominio llamado mail.maribel.com

Procedemos a editar nuestra zona directa, la cual se encuentra en
/var/named/zone.di

7

Ahora vamos a reiniciar nuestro servicio DNS, si este falla es porque la zona directa
est mal configurada.

Ahora editaremos el archivo de configuracin de Correo, para esto nos dirigimos a la
siguiente ruta /etc/postfix/main.cf
Nos dirigimos a la lnea 75 y colocamos nuestro subdominio

En la lnea 83 especificamos nuestro dominio

Descomentamos la lnea 98



8

Descomentamos la lnea 113

Descomentamos la lnea 165

Descomentamos la lnea 264 y aadimos nuestra Red

Agregamos lo siguiente en la lnea 297



9

Descomentamos la lnea 317 y agregamos nuestra ip

Descomentamos la lnea 419, guardamos y salimos

Reiniciamos nuestro servicio Postfix

Establecemos el servicio Postfix para que se inicie con el sistema

Comprobamos que el puerto 25 este escuchando, como podemos observar dice
LISTEN


10

Confirmemos tener nuestro firewall abajo y nuestro SElinux deshabilitado



Instalamos el Telnet con el comando yum install -y


Ahora verificamos que si este instalado el Telnet con el comando rpm q telnet

11

Al completar la instalacin, reiniciamos nuestra mquina para comprobar que todo se
encuentre instalado y funcionando satisfactoriamente con el comando reboot
Reiniciamos nuestro servicio DNS y lo recargamos

Tambin reiniciamos nuestro servicio Postfix

Revisemos nuevamente que nuestro firewall se encuentre abajo

Ahora haremos una conexin telnet a nuestro subdominio por el puerto 25

Escribimos ehlo localhost

12

Ahora comprobaremos la conexin Telnet, con un usuario configurado en nuestro
LDAP
Copiamos lo siguiente: mail from:ldapuser3@ maribel.com

Comprobemos la conexin con otro usuario
Copiamos lo siguiente: rcpt to:ldapuser4@maribel.com


13

Enviemos un correo local de prueba por la conexin de Telnet

Salimos con quit
En system-Administration-Users and groups podemos observar los usuarios
habilitados de Ldap para hacer pruebas

14


Ahora observaremos grficamente si el correo local le llego al usuario Ldapuser4
Damos clic en Computer

Filesystem




15

Luego en la carpeta Home

Guests

Ldapuser4

Dentro de la carpeta del usuario Ldapuser4 abriremos la carpeta llamada Maildir y
dentro de esta abriremos la carpeta llamada New


16

Para poder leer el correo debemos dar clic derecho sobre el documento open with
Gedit

Como podemos observar nos ha llegado el mensaje correctamente y tambin
podemos ver la fecha, la hora y la persona que nos envi el mensaje.
En este caso fue el da mircoles 14 de mayo de 2014 a las 6:51 y nos lo envi el
usuario Ldapuser3.



17

Ahora procederemos a enviarles mensajes a todos los usuarios Ldap para que se
creen los directorios Maildir
Los enviaremos por correos internos de la siguiente manera:







18

Ahora vamos a instalar el servidor Dovecot el cual nos permite transportar un correo
al exterior del servidor.


Verificamos que si se halla instalado

Reiniciamos el servidor Dovecot y le asignamos que se inicie con el sistema

Comprobemos que el puerto 143 este escuchando



19

Comprobemos si el puerto 110 tambin est escuchando

Procederemos a editar algunos archivos del servidor Dovecot
El primero que vamos a editar es el /etc/Dovecot/Dovecot.conf

Descomentamos la lnea 20

Descomentamos la lnea 26 y borramos los residuos

Guardamos y salimos
Ahora editaremos los archivos de la siguiente ruta:



20

Descomentamos la lnea 9 y le colocamos no al final

Aadimos lo siguiente en la lnea 97

Guardamos y salimos
Ahora editaremos el siguiente archivo

Descomentamos la lnea 24

Guardamos y salimos
Ahora reiniciamos nuestro servicio Dovecot

21

Ahora comprobaremos mediante Telnet el protocolo Pop3

Como podemos observar se conecta satisfactoriamente con el ldapuser1
Ahora comprobaremos el telnet por el puerto 143

Como podemos observar se conecta satisfactoriamente con el usuario ldapuser2




22

Miramos los logs para ver el proceso de error

Ahora revisaremos el correo de forma grfica en Red Hat mediante el directorio
Maildir del usuario Root

Reiniciamos nuestro servicio Dovecot



23

COMPROBACIN DEL SERVIDOR DE CORREO DE FORMA REMOTA
Para probar el servidor de correo de forma remota utilice el sistema operativo
Windows Xp y este tiene instalado el Software llamado ThunderBird.
Ahora vamos a verificar nuestra Ip y nuestro Dominio

Comprobaremos un ping a nuestro sub dominio mail.maribel.com




24

Ahora vamos a instalar ThunderBird
Lo podemos descargar desde: http://thunderbird.uptodown.com/descargar
Clic en siguiente

Seleccionamos la opcin estndar Siguiente

25

Damos clic en Instalar

Esperamos a que se instale

26

Clic en finalizar

Como podemos observar ya hemos instalado el ThunderBird


27

Damos clic en correo electrnico y seleccionamos la opcin de saltarse esto y usar
mi cuenta de correo existente

Configuramos la cuenta de correo de la siguiente manera y al finalizar damos clic en
continuar.

28

Esperamos a que se cargue la configuracin y observamos que la configuracin
queda tal cual como la siguiente imagen y al finalizar damos clic en hecho

Seleccionamos la opcin Entiendo los riesgos Hecho

29

Como podemos observar ya hemos creado nuestro usuario Ldapuser1 a ThunderBird

Damos clic en Bandeja de entrada y podemos observar que tenemos un mensaje del
usuario Root

Ahora daremos clic en redactar para enviarle un mensaje a un usuario Ldap en este
caso al usuario Ldapuser2. Al terminar damos clic en enviar

30

Damos clic en enviados y podemos observar que hemos enviado un mensaje al
Ldapuser2

NOTA: Recordemos que para poder leer los mensajes recibidos de cualquier usuario
tenemos que ser usuario Root
Buscamos el usuario Ldapuser2, damos clic derecho sobre el mensaje abrir con
gedit


31

Como podemos observar nos ha llegado el mensaje exitosamente












32

CAPTURAS WIRESHARK

También podría gustarte